Senior Electronic Engineer
Job Title
Senior Electronic Engineer
Location: Stockholm area, Sweden
Work Model: On-site / Hybrid
Team: Multinational R&D environment
Role Overview
An innovative technology company is expanding its electronics development team and is seeking a Senior Electronic Engineer to support the design and development of advanced energy systems.
The organisation develops compact, high-performance fuel cell technology designed for applications where space, efficiency, and reliability are critical. These solutions are used across sectors such as e-mobility, robotics, autonomous vehicles, and industrial applications.
You will join a growing R&D team and play a key role in taking products from early concept through to fully validated production-ready designs, with ownership across the full product lifecycle.
Key Responsibilities
As a Senior Electronic Engineer, you will be responsible for:
-
Designing and developing electronic and electrical circuits for control systems and embedded applications
-
Contributing to concept development and technical architecture decisions
-
Working closely with electronics manufacturers and suppliers on prototype builds and series production solutions
-
Implementing and validating designs through:
-
Circuit design and simulation
-
Analysis and commissioning
-
Laboratory testing and troubleshooting
-
Technical documentation and design verification
-
-
Supporting the product lifecycle from concept sketches to finished product, ensuring high quality and robust performance
Required Background & Skills
Education & Experience
-
University degree in Electronics, Electrical Engineering, Embedded Systems, or a related discipline
-
Several years’ experience in electronic design, ideally within innovative or R&D-focused environments
-
Experience working with prototypes and early-stage product development
Technical Skills
-
Strong knowledge of analog and digital circuit design
-
Experience with signal electronics and hardware design
-
Programming or scripting experience in Python, MATLAB, and/or C/C++
-
Hands-on laboratory experience, including:
-
Soldering (SMD and through-hole components)
-
Circuit testing, debugging, and measurement
-
Use of standard electronic lab equipment
-
Ways of Working
-
Comfortable working in a fast-moving, multidisciplinary development team
-
Able to take ownership and responsibility across the full product lifecycle
-
Strong documentation and communication skills
Languages
-
Fluent English (written and spoken)
-
Swedish language skills are highly desirable and beneficial for collaboration and long-term integration
What’s on Offer
-
Opportunity to work on cutting-edge energy and electronics technology
-
End-to-end involvement in product development
-
Collaborative, international R&D environment
-
Strong technical ownership and influence over design decisions
